Charlene Ruto storms New York with her fashion.

Written by on September 26, 2024

The first daughter, Charlene Ruto, is currently in New York as part of a Kenyan delegation attending the 79th UN General Assembly meeting. 

She has been sharing photos and a video of herself walking around New York, blowing kisses at the camera. 

For her outing, she wore a burnt orange skirt, a white long-sleeved shirt, and a grey coat, with her hair styled in braids held up in three buns, and carried a black handbag. 

Charlene expressed her joy, saying, “Today…I walked into The Future…” while playing the background music from Alicia Keys’s Empire State of Mind, a song about hope and possibility in New York. 

Charlene also addressed a gathering on Monday, September 23. She is in New York as part of the Summit of the Future 2024, representing her organisation, Smart Mechanized Agriculture & Climate Action for Humanity & Sustainability (SMACHS Foundation).
